The PERED direct reduction process converts iron oxides in the form of pellets or lump ore to highly reduced product suitable for steel making The reduction of iron oxide takes place without its melting with the help of reducing gases in solid state in a vertical shaft furnace

The binder is an important additive widely applied in pelletizing iron ore concentrates making iron ore pellets available as feedstocks for blast furnace ironmaking or direct reduction processes
